Âé¶¹ÊÓÆµ Denver COVID-19 Response Plan

The safety and well-being of the Âé¶¹ÊÓÆµ community—our AmeriCorps members, students, staff members, partners and the broader communities we serve—is always our top priority. In alignment with Denver Public Schools and recommendations from the CDC, our office is closed to the public and our AmeriCorps members will remain out of public schools until further notice.

Our site leadership team is managing contingency plans and we are in close communication with the Corporation for National and Community Service to create options and scenarios for a variety of situations that may arise.
